  2. IBSH isn’t just about academic achievements. With over 30 clubs to choose from, students are encouraged not only to challenge themselves academically, but also to excel in other areas of life.

  3. Interest Clubs

  4. Interest Clubs IBSH has a variety of interest clubs ranging from break dancing, to debate, to anime appreciation, to UNICEF, to Model United Nations (MUN).

  14. Service Clubs

  15. Service Clubs Service clubs allow students to contribute their time and effort to people and areas outside of the school. These clubs create unique learning experiences that focus on caring for the environment, helping others, teamwork, and friendship.

  18. Charity Night An annual concert co hosted by key and interact where students have a chance to show off their musical talents. There is usually a game show hosted at the end of every concert. All profits made go to a charity organization.

  19. Unplugged The last concert of the school year. All performances are recorded into a CD for students and teachers to purchase.

  22. Beat Concert An annual concert co-hosted by interact and the experimental department student council. Several local Taiwanese high schools are also invited to participate.

  24. Bilingual Department Student Council -- BDSC

  25. BDSC is of the students, for the students. We not only host dances and other fun activities for the student body, but we also act as the bridge of communication between the administration and our students.

  30. Spirit Week A week where 7-12 graders show off their grade spirit for a chance to win prizes. Different dress up themes and games are designed for every day of the week, and scores for each grade are accumulated based on participation.

  31. Spirit Week Monday: Tacky Wacky

  32. Spirit Week Tuesday: Pokemon

  33. Spirit WeekWednesday: Crazy Hair + Grade Color + Twin

  34. Spirit Week Thursday: PJ’s Day

  35. Spirit Week Friday: Super Hero/Villain
